What is CVE-2026-32682?

An authenticated remote attacker with permission to create or modify GRPCRoute resources in NGINX Gateway Fabric can exploit a configuration flaw. By sending malicious GRPCRoute configurations that contain backendRef filters, the attacker can cause the control plane of NGINX Gateway Fabric to terminate unexpectedly, leading to potential service disruptions and loss of functionality.

Affected Version(s)

NGINX Gateway Fabric 1.3.0 < 2.6.4
